
Bitcoin is witnessing a significant resurgence as institutional investors are making a robust return to the market. Recent reports indicate that crypto investment products experienced inflows of $1.2 billion last week, marking the fourth consecutive week of positive trends. Notably, Bitcoin alone accounted for an impressive $933 million of these inflows, highlighting renewed confidence among large investors. Ethereum also saw substantial interest, attracting $192 million. The United States has emerged as a key player in this recovery, contributing $1.1 billion to the overall demand for crypto assets, which has led to a notable increase in total assets under management in the sector.
To understand the current dynamics, it is essential to consider the broader context of the cryptocurrency market. After a prolonged period of bearish sentiment, where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ies faced significant price declines, the recent inflows signal a shift in investor sentiment. This influx of capital comes amidst ongoing discussions around regulatory frameworks and macroeconomic factors that influence the crypto landscape. The Federal Reserve's monetary policy, particularly its stance on interest rates, plays a crucial role in shaping the investment climate, and many believe that their decisions will impact the trajectory of Bitcoin's price moving forward.
The implications of these inflows are considerable for the cryptocurrency market. As institutional confidence grows, it could lead to increased price stability and further institutional adoption. A steady inflow of capital may also pave the way for Bitcoin to reclaim previous highs, as large investors typically have a more significant impact on market dynamics compared to retail investors. This shift could serve to bolster the legitimacy of cryptocurrencies as viable investment assets, potentially attracting even more institutional interest in the future.
Industry experts have weighed in on this positive trend, emphasizing the importance of macroeconomic factors in the current environment. Many analysts believe that the Fed's decisions regarding interest rates will be pivotal in determining the sustainability of this bullish momentum. Some experts argue that if the Fed signals a dovish approach, it could further stimulate investment in risk assets like Bitcoin. Conversely, a more hawkish stance could dampen enthusiasm and lead to volatility. Overall, the consensus is that while the recent inflows are encouraging, they are closely tied to external economic indicators.
Looking ahead, the focus will remain on the Federal Reserve and its forthcoming monetary policy decisions. Investors are keenly monitoring any signals that could indicate the Fed's approach to interest rates, as this will likely influence market sentiment in the coming weeks. Additionally, if the current trend of inflows continues, we may see further developments in institutional adoption and new investment products tailored to the cryptocurrency market. The interplay between institutional demand and regulatory developments will be crucial to watch as Bitcoin's recovery unfolds.
